Electra Protocol Blockchain, Multi Layer Explorer
Supply: 18,324,092,626 Lastest Block: 1,960,902 Utxos: 1,983,748
Nodes: 374 OmniXEP Contracts: 274
Address balances
ep1qexq5khzt7gtv5df0k4fxdk0gq4v0lx36362gcy
XEPElectra Protocol [XEP]
Balance
0
No omnixep tokens